Port Pirie Area
Port Pirie lies on the eastern shores of Spencer Gulf and has a proud industrial heritage centred on its lead and zinc smelter, yet it also offers art deco architecture, waterfront parks and the Southern Flinders Ranges nearby. Museums tell stories of maritime history and local football rivalries, while cafés in heritage buildings serve regional produce. Locals share directions to a quiet jetty where dolphins sometimes swim close and a railway tunnel that hosts underground art installations.
Council has an approximate area of 1,800 km².
